Relationships: The Heart of Development and Learning

Relationships: The Heart of Development and Learning is one of three infant/toddler modules created to support consultants working in child care settings, especially consultants who have not had education or training specific to infants and toddlers in group care. These modules were designed to compliment training offered to early childhood consultants through the National Training Institute at the Department of Maternal and Child Health, University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ill.

The infant/toddler modules, which also include Infant/Toddler Development, Screening and Assessment and Infant/Toddler Curriculum and Individualization, provide content on early development and quality child care policies and practices for consultants working in child care settings serving children ages birth to 3. The modules do not include a focus on the development of consultation skills. As such, they are not intended to be used as stand-alone trainings but should be incorporated into training that also addresses the critical skills and process of consultation.
